[QUOTE="guardianbs, post: 1222929, member: 116317"] Sorry for not responding sooner - I didn't get an email to say the thread had been updated. I have tested the modified dll. There is some good news . . . and some bad news. The good news - The dll does create xml and add entries in the TV database for all files created. The bad news (well disappointing news anyway) - The merged file is not being created correctly. It seems to create the merged file at the same time as the timeshift buffer file is created when starting the Recording, and the merged file does not contain any of the Recording file and is shorter than the timeshift buffer file - the end is truncated. The separate timeshift buffer file and the follow on Recording file work ok. [/QUOTE]
